Interrupt Selection
Register
The Interrupt Selection Register (address 20
h
) specifies which VXI interrupt
line the M-Module will use. M-Modules may generate interrupts to indicate
that a SCPI command has completed. These interrupts are sent to and
acknowledged by the Agilent Command Module or other system controller
via one of seven VXI backplane interrupt lines. Different controllers treat
the interrupt lines differently, and you should refer to your controller’s
documentation to determine how to set the interrupt level. Agilent
Command Modules configured as VXI Resource Managers treat all
interrupt lines as having equal priority. For interrupters using the same line,
priority is determined by which slot they are installed in; lower-numbered
slots have higher priority than higher-numbered slots. Agilent Command
Modules service line 1 by default, so it is normally correct to leave the
interrupt level set to the factory default of IRQ1.
If your controller’s documentation instructs you to change the interrupt
level, you need to specify the level in the VXI Interrupt Selection Register.
To cause the M-Module to interrupt on one of the VXI interrupt lines, write
to the appropriate bits (refer to table below). To disable the module’s
interrupt, set the bits to 000. Selecting other than the default interrupt line 1
is not recommended. Reading the default value of this register returns the
value XXX9
h
.
M-Module specifications define three types of interrupts. The INT bit (bit 3)
determines which M-Module interrupt style is supported. If INT is set to a
0, the M-Module supports interrupt types A and B. If INT is set to a 1, the
M-Module supports interrupt type C (this is the default).
Type A Interrupts The interrupting M-Module removes the interrupt
request upon a register access (software method) to the
interrupting M-Module (such as reading the Status
Register). DTACK* is not asserted during interrupt
acknowledge.
